Proposal
TR02 Tree on Great Eastern Street car park land owned by Cambridge City Council nearest to the Mill Road / Great Eastern Street junction to be crown lifted to give 5m clearance above ground level, 5m from the level of the footway Public Car Park, Great Eastern Street, Cambridge Cambridgeshire CB1 3AB. TR01 Trees along the boundary of the Argyle Street Housing Co-operative car park with Mill Road, for a length of 35m, to be crown lifted/reduced to give 5m clearance above ground level 5m from the level of the footway. TR03 Tree outside 124 Mill Road, Cambridge CB1 2BQ to be crown lifted/reduced to give 5m clearance above ground level 5m from the level of the footway.

About tree works applications
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.

TR02 - Plane (London) (Platanus x hispanica) - Crown lifted to give 5m clearance above ground level, ie. 5m from the level of the footway and up to the back edge of the footway. I wish this to be a repeat operation at intervals for 10 years (ie. I don't wish the permission to default to two years). This is because Cambridgeshire County Council have installed road signs and enforcement cameras as part of the Mill Road Bus Gate scheme. Pruning works are to clear low branches above height of signs and camera sight lines.
